Decision: Refuse Planning Permission/Consent
Decision date: 20 Feb 2020
Conditions and reasons:

1)

The proposal by reason of its proposed height, width, bulk, scale and mass would fail to read as a subordinate addition to the host property and fail to respect the established rhythm of rear additions in the group of buildings. As a result, the proposal fails to preserve or enhance the character and appearance of the group of buildings and the Royal Hospital Conservation Area, contrary to policies CL1, CL2, CL3, CL6, CL9 and CL11 of the Local Plan 2019.

2)

The proposal fails to demonstrate that the height, depth and position of the new closet wing would not harmfully block daylight or sunlight to neighbouring buildings. As a result, the proposal fails to ensure that good living conditions would continue for neighbouring occupants contrary to policy CL5 of the Local Plan 2019.
